1. Odor and Ventilation: Oil-based paints have a robust odor and require enough air flow during utility and drying.
2. Drying Time: Oil-based paint takes longer to dry in comparability with water-based paints, which might prolong the general project timeline.
3. Cleanup: Oil-based paint requires mineral spirits or turpentine for cleanup, which can be tougher and fewer environmentally friendly than water-based paint cleanup.
4. Yellowing Over Time: Some oil-based paints could yellow over time, especially in areas with minimal natural mild or exposure to UV rays.
5. Regulations: Check native laws relating to using oil-based paints, as they could have particular disposal and dealing with requirements.

1. Scope of Work:
Clearly outline the scope of work you need, together with the variety of rooms, walls, ceilings, and any additional surfaces like trim or doorways to be painted.
2. Surface Preparation:
Ask concerning the extent of surface preparation included in the estimate, similar to patching holes, sanding, and priming before portray.

3. Type of Paint:
Inquire concerning the kind and high quality of paint products that will be used, together with manufacturers, finishes, and whether eco-friendly options can be found.

4. Labor and Material Costs:
Understand the breakdown of costs for labor, materials, and any extra providers like furniture shifting or cleanup.

5. Timeline and Scheduling:
Discuss the expected timeline for finishing the project and availability of the portray contractor to accommodate your schedule.

2. Warm Weather (70°F to 90°F):
- Painting in hotter temperatures can velocity up drying instances, so work in smaller sections to avoid lap marks.
- Paint early in the morning or late in the afternoon to avoid direct sunlight on freshly painted areas.
